The mesas and canyons of rural Utah are both beautiful and unforgiving–as unforgiving as the locals in Sharperville, who will never see Jamie Sundstrom as anything other than the no-good daughter of the town drunk. Now, two years after losing her own daughter in a nasty custody battle, Jamie is saving every penny from her job as a backhoe operator for a good lawyer. Her heart is as battered as her rundown car–until a soft-spoken, easy-on-the-eyes cowboy drifts into town…Cal Cameron is trying to adjust to his new normal, working on his sister’s farm after recovering from the rodeo wreck that ended his championship career. At first sight, he can tell that Jamie is is guarded. But as she slowly lets him into her world, he’ll do anything to help her get her daughter back–even if it means finally letting go of the man he was and becoming a different kind of hero…
